10/14/21 Access to God’s Presence

“Have you done what I’ve asked you to do? Do you even know what I’ve asked you to do or not do? Have you spent enough time with Me to know My heart? If you have, you know that I’m not looking for you to work hard for Me. I am looking for you to be with Me. That is what Jesus spent His life for. He gave you access to My Presence. I see you through the blood that He shed.

"I know you because you have responded to His Lordship. Stop attempting to impress Me with your works. They matter little if We are not doing them together. Come to Me through Jesus. We will talk. We will reason. We will work together after you have submitted to My heart.”

 John 5:19-20 NIV

19) Jesus gave them this answer: “I tell you the truth, the Son can do nothing by himself; he can do only what he sees his Father doing, because whatever the Father does the Son also does.

20) For the Father loves the Son and shows him all he does.

Luke 6:43-46 NIV 

43) “No good tree bears bad fruit, nor does a bad tree bear good fruit.

44) Each tree is recognized by its own fruit. People do not pick figs from thornbushes, or grapes from briers.

45) The good man brings good things out of the good stored up in his heart, and the evil man brings evil things out of the evil stored up in his heart. For out of the overflow of his heart his mouth speaks.

46) “Why do you call me, ‘Lord, Lord,’ and do not do what I say?”

 

Submission to the Father’s heart is a priority. So many of us take the work of the cross for our salvation and minimize the fact that the work of Jesus has won back the right for us to be in the presence of God the Father. Jesus shed blood was the only sacrifice accepted by God. Most of us tend to forget how important it is to use this astounding privilege.

Take some time to think about how miserable our existence would be without access to God. Think how horrible it would be if we could not go to Him for direction, guidance, and assurance. Remember the price that was paid for you and me the next time you pray and those prayers are answered. Thank Him for devising a means for us to return to Him as often as we desire.

10/12/21 Conviction vs. Condemnation

“Discern the difference between condemnation and conviction. I will never even hint toward condemning you. A great price has been paid so that We can fellowship together and spend eternity with each other. To have done all of that, and then condemn you after you have surrendered yourself completely to Jesus, would be unthinkable.

"My heart is always for you. I am always on your side as you keep coming closer to Me. Rest assured, I will be in your corner cheering you on, using all My resources on your behalf as you submit to the work of the cross. I will continually encourage you. I will also convict your heart of those things that harm you and Our fellowship together. I tell you of those things because I love you. Respond to My conviction; cast aside any form of condemnation. It is never from Me.”

Rev. 3:19 AMP

Those whom I [dearly and tenderly] love, I tell their faults and convict and convince and reprove and chasten [I discipline and instruct them]. So be enthusiastic and in earnest and burning with zeal and repent [changing your mind and attitude].

 

So many of us are so in the habit of defending ourselves that we even try to do it when the Lord starts to convict us of those areas that need to be changed.  This world has gone so far astray from the truth that it seems as though most everything has migrated from definitive right and wrong into a muddy shade of gray. The Word of God, however, never does that with sin. Father God never condescends to our way of thinking. He calls sin exactly what it is – sin.

Even though we have been forgiven, have a new nature, strive toward holiness, and have access to sit on our loving Abba’s lap, we all still sin. It sure is wonderful to have Someone Who loves us so much and is always available to show us when we stray from the path. Never condemning, always on our side, never giving up on us, our Father leads us from the horrors of this world into a life of freedom—one conviction and subsequent repentance at a time. What an incredible relationship!

10/09/21 Live the Word

“It is time to seek truth with all your might so that you walk in it. There is little time to allow perceived truth, personal perspective, and hindering traditions to sway you to hazardous places. Clean up your lives. Be set free from any hindrances that have been part of who you are because of the lies of the enemy, or the clutter that has allowed you to believe something that’s not true. Forgive everyone in your past relationships. Deny access to the familiar lies in your head about who you are, who you are not, or who you can or cannot be.

"Seek My Word. Allow it to tell you who I have called you to be. Take the time to allow My Word to change any part of your thinking that is out of order with eternal truth. I am present in it to proclaim what really is and is not. Search for Me. I can be found if you seek Me with all your heart. I will show you absolute truth. You can stake your life on what My Word says. In fact, you must.”

Amos 5:4b AMP 

…Seek Me [inquire for and of Me and require Me as you require food] and you shall live!

Mark 4: 24 AMP

And He said to them, Be careful what you are hearing. The measure [of thought and study] you give [to the truth you hear] will be the measure [of virtue and knowledge] that comes back to you – and more [besides] will be given to you who hear.

Colossians 1:9-12 NIV

9) For this reason, since the day we heard about you, we have not stopped praying for you and asking God to fill you with the knowledge of his will through all spiritual wisdom and understanding.

10) And we pray this in order that you may live a life worthy of the Lord and may please him in every way: bearing fruit in every good work, growing in the knowledge of God,

11) being strengthened with all power according to his glorious might so that you may have great endurance and patience, and joyfully

12) giving thanks to the Father, who has qualified you to share in the inheritance of the saints in the kingdom of light.

 

Most of the world spends more time picking out their wardrobe than they do deeply investigating what happens after they close their eyes for the last time. In the same way, most of the church walks around in half-truths, perceived notions, and flat-out blind traditions. We cling to teachings with little or no biblical foundation, just because it feels right or ministers to some part of our carnal nature; and never give a thought as to whether or not God is pleased with our foolishness.

We need to get serious. This is serious business—this God business. Every one of us should have only God’s desires as the primary focus of our lives. Whatever it takes, we need to get to really know our God, and what His Word actually says. Then we need to live by it.
